Getting Started.

After unpacking the recorder, place on a firm stable surface and, if the room is warm, allow 15 to 20 minutes
to acclimatise before using as there may be condensation on the laser optical lens. Please remember to
keep the packaging away from small children and animals and keep safe, it may be needed in the future.
Connections.
See pages 10 to 12 for typical connections. The basic connections should be used until you are familiar with
the operations of the recorder. It is wise not to add extra items such as HiFi amplifiers etc until you know the
recorder is working as expected. If you wish to add items such as Hi Fi amplifiers, add one item at once and
ensure it is working before adding another item.
Switching on.
Connect to a suitable mains supply (110 – 240V AC 50/60 Hz). The recorder will take approx 30 seconds
before the digital display lights up. This is normal, you will, in this time hear the DVD player mechanism
activating.
Press the Standby button. The display will blank for a few seconds and then the message "HELLO" will be
shown. "READ" will then be displayed, and as this is the first time the recorder is used it will then show "NO
DISC".
The TV screen will now display the "Splash Screen" and also will display "NO DISC"
